About the role

Key Responsibilities:

  • Maintain overall architecture ownership and governance for all Orange solutions within a particular customer environment. 
  • Ensure life-cycle management and technology road-map planning with a focus on solution innovation.
  • Assess feasibility, identify and clarify technical, delivery and operational risks for proposed new technologies and services.
  • Provide governance and quality assurance for the delivery of all Orange technical services.
  • Lead and deliver consulting services when required, including development of High Level Designs, Low Level Designs, Site Migration Plans and communication and liaison with other stakeholders to ensure successful implementation.
  • Ensure best practice is leveraged in providing the solutions and services to target accounts.
  • Establish structure and contribute material for knowledge management so that we become a learning organisation - ensuring Orange Business Services replicate success and don't repeat mistakes. 
  • Advanced knowledge and expertise providing support to customers, on all Orange services, transferring customers’ requirements into a solution based on Orange Business Services’ products, solutions and services. Owns quality assurance for all low-level technical design from concept to subsequent implementation; and when required, responsible for design, configuration, testing and commissioning of solutions.
  • Maintain a high degree of technical knowledge of all Orange Business Services’ products, solutions and services. Use this knowledge to ensure that all proposed designs are commercially and technically viable solutions for the Customer.
  • Responsible for governance and oversight, ensuring technical management of deployment issues and problems. Note and ensure escalation within Orange product teams, service developments required to meet customer needs.
  • Ensure adoption of Professional Services (PS) processes, methods and tools throughout Australasia.
  • Identify and create business opportunities for Orange Business Services target customers and prospects.
  • When required, participate in the tendering process and development of proposals in line with customer needs, liaising and qualifying with other colleagues as necessary. Present technical solutions to customers both formally and informally as required. Supports in the development of customer SLAs. 
  • Stay abreast of technical issues, options and advancements within the internetworking industry relevant to the Orange Business Services’ portfolio.
  • Provide a consistently high quality technical service to target customers ensuring that customer satisfaction is maintained or improved.
  • Ability to liaise with customers unaccompanied and be a recognized authority on Orange Business Services’ products and services.
  • Provision of skilled presentations to prospective customers on the technical solutions and services offered by Orange Business Services with minimum support.
  • Responsible for all aspects of the technical compatibility of customer requirements with the products and services offered by Orange Business Services.

About you

Knowledge and abilities

  • Ability to engage and partner with customer at a high level governance and detailed technical level
  • Highly customer focused and willing to champion the customer needs throughout the organisation
  • Engage and partner with customer at all levels, including high level governance and at a detailed technical level
  • Ensure delivery of solutions which provide high value throughout the full life cycle of the contract
  • Deliver high value, consulting services as appropriate
  • Work with and enhance key partner and vendor relationships as required to deliver fully integrated solutions

Profile:

  • Good problem solving, organisational and communication skills 
  • Must be capable of working across cultural boundaries 
  • Positive thinker, confident, presentable, enthusiastic, resilient 
  • Able to multi-task, to take ownership, to prioritise and to meet deadlines
  • No difficulties travelling internationally
  • Capable of building and maintaining good relationships
  • Capable of working in a matrix organisation
  • Capable of mentoring and leading less experienced technical staff
  • Engineering Degree or similar in relevant technical field
  • Vendors certifications (e.g. Juniper, Z-Scaler, Cisco)
  • Consulting practitioner (such as TOGAF or similar)
  • Minimum of 15+ years related work experience in customer facing organizations within the telecom or IT industry or equivalent. 
  • Experience and/or knowledge of the following key technologies: Network, Security, Infrastructure and Cloud
